MARCHING BAND BANQUET

 You volunteered to help to help with the marching band banquet.  The most important thing is that we find a replacement for me for next year & the years to come.  I've done the leg work.  Hired the CHS Culinary Art students to provide the dinner.  He is happy to do it for $5.25 per person as long as the banquet isn't the same week as the school break.  Keith fills out the school forms.  We need a podium & microphone.  I designed the flyer.  [Well actually this year my alumnae decided to spice it up as a good bye gift.  Next year just change the dates And the pictures.  I copied the pictures off the website.]  I am collecting the money from the brown box.  We have all the decorations from last year.

Have I recruited anyone yet????????

Now comes the hard part.  The set up & clean up.  The jobs I need help with.  First of all we have the cafeteria starting at 4:30.

We need to start the coffee & buy it [cups, sugar, cream ...]; revelcro the helmets; put out candy in bowls on each table & buy it; put up the decorations & bring the tape;  put out the table cloths [ we have 15 white & 15 purple] & buy a few more; order get & put out helium balloons; and clean up [But not until we are completely done!! I will tell you when.  Not before that!!].

So you can see this is very simple little job!! for next year!!

And oh yes there is always the "oh by the way list" probably like putting extra cans of soda in trash cans of ice.
